Output d5859891e7ced77fc1ea9cef9bce08af7c2b165acd4b1fcb9604c6881fc93d55:109

value
131072
script pubkey
OP_0 OP_PUSHBYTES_20 24597f5da6c7259cafc55f5fc35c67b5e3144790
address
bc1qy3vh7hdxcujeet79ta0uxhr8kh33g3usmlkltd
transaction
d5859891e7ced77fc1ea9cef9bce08af7c2b165acd4b1fcb9604c6881fc93d55
spent
true